Job Description

Univision Television Group, Inc. in Chicago, IL seeks a full-time News Producer to prepare rundowns, assign, write, review, and edit all news scripts; control quality of copy, video, and graphics to ensure a high‑quality newscast, produce streaming content, breaking news, and severe weather, and create graphics as needed for shows.
Responsibilities

Write, edit, and manage all news scripts and briefs for the Spanish‑language broadcast network.
Prepare and oversee rundowns, assignments, and live remote coverage, including severe weather and breaking news.
Create graphics for shows using CANVA and support the station’s websites and social media channels.
Conduct computer‑assisted reporting, research, and database analysis, and navigate open‑records laws such as FOIA.
Act as line producer, coordinating technical and editorial needs with reporters, anchors, camera staff, engineers, and news management.
Ensure integrity and quality of the newscast from pre‑production through execution.
Make quick, informed decisions in collaboration with the news team to achieve a visually compelling broadcast.
Research, develop, and produce investigative stories for the network.
Qualifications

Bachelor’s degree in Communications, Journalism, or a related field.
Minimum of 5 years of experience as a television producer or in the same occupation.
Fluent in written and spoken Spanish and experienced in producing live Spanish‑language news.
Experience writing and executing news scripts, including interview‑related scripts, for Spanish‑language television.
Proficiency in Final Cut, Avid, and INews.
Strong knowledge of CANVA graphic‑design technology.
Deep understanding of editorial standards, ethics, and legal matters pertaining to broadcast.
Salary

The annual salary for this role in IL is $75,000.
